i haven't been able to start the slaverun questline, none of my quests look like they are a prequest and i have tried talking to The Jarl of Whiterun but it gave no options. 

 

How do i start the prequest? In the MCM, it is saying i have a prequest. 

 

I can't remember exactly since I use the feature in Sexlab Survival to autostart Slaverun and skip the prequest. It's been years since I last did the prequest, my memory here might be wrong...

 

What I remember is that you are supposed to get a letter from the courier to start the prequest. There is an MCM setting to control at what level you get that letter, the default is level 2. Read the letter then the prequest sends you to talk to the Jarl of Whiterun.

well, there is a way to complete the quest through the console, just follow the steps:
1- open the console and type without the quotes '' save funclist 1 ''
2- look for the name of the quest in the notepad file that will open and then find it, write down the quest ID.
3- Go back to the game and put in the console '' player.sqs quest_id '' ( replacing '' quest_id '' by the id you wrote down ).
4- a list of stages will appear in which the quest is, if it has a number x = 1 it is because you completed that stage and 0 is because you did not complete or reached that stage.
5- Look for the stage you want to go to, if your goal is to complete the stage it is usually the last stage you want, but be careful because one of the last stages if I'm not mistaken has a stage to indicate that you failed the quest.
6- To finish, just put in the console '' set_stage quest_id stage_number '', respectively replacing the quest_id with the id you wrote down and stage_number with the number of the stage you want to go to.

 

I also thought if you want to try to complete this quest ( I don't remember this quest, are you doing the slaver or slave questline ? ), try to do the following:
1- open the console and click on npc.
2- type ''prid'' without the quotes in the console or '' prid ref_ID ''.
3- put '' moveto player '' next to the wagon that Mundus said was to take and see if there is any dialogue because sometimes the dialogue only appears if the npc is in designed place of the quest.

I've played a lot of skyrim, including slaverun as a slaver, slave and citizen, although I must admit that I hate being a slave and don't play that role often.  I also tend to avoid mundus' tasks.  I've can't recall anyone named Jasmin (which might mean that I simply can't recall her).  Most of the slaves a slave or slaver is tasked to escort are generically named slaves.  A few times you might be tasked to escort someone named, like "arrested whore".  The typical scenario is that you are told what to do, you talk to pike (or mundus) again, the slave to escort pops up near you.  Off you go.

 

Slaverun is very script heavy.  Other mods can be script heavy and the combination can cause problems.  Sometimes, like someone told you, reloading an earlier save lets the quest operate normally.  Sometimes one can save, quit, restart skyrim and it functions as it should.  One thing you can try is that when you are about to enter dragonsreach, turn enforcer off in the slaverun mcm.  This might reduce the load enough to allow things to continue.
